    History: 
    Rig-el grew up on Magna-Lor, a decent happy kid who wanted to grow up to be a Seer, and hoped to be a Prophet like his father. That didn’t happen. His father knew everything that Arolla-Nor foresaw … and he also foresaw her treachery to the Lor Republic. So his parents packed up their sons in an augmented Preserver-Tech ship, and sent them to Earth, knowing the journey itself would transform them and make them ready for their new world.

     

    Personality & Motivation:
    Mostly Rigel does what his father told him to … protect his siblings and protect others. It isn’t that it’s a burden, totally, but he wishes he could be a slightly normaler young man; by Lor standards or by Earth standards, the hero gig takes a lot out of you.
    Modeling, though, does not really take a lot out of him, and his resources were created by the AI of their ship en-route; he really can spend all day saving the city when he needs to.

     

    Powers & Tactics:
    Rig-el’s powers derive from his early Seer training, but they also diverge into the extraordinary because his father planned for it.
    His Psionic Energy Matrix allows him to do some incredible things, but primarily, he flies and blasts things with his psychokinetic vision.
    He is practicing a broader, more balanced approach to his energy allocations, particularly to be faster.
    Both he and his little brother practice the powers the other is better at together on Sundays: for now, their littler brother mostly watches and studies.
